
时间:2024-10-29 来源:网络 人气:


在竞争激烈的市场环境中,企业需要高效、精准的销售管理系统来提高销售业绩。传统的销售管理方式存在诸多弊端,如信息孤岛、数据不准确、流程繁琐等。ASP.NET销售管理系统应运而生,它能够帮助企业实现销售过程的自动化、智能化,提高销售效率。

ASP.NET销售管理系统主要包括以下功能模块:
1. 客户管理模块
客户管理模块负责对客户信息进行录入、查询、修改和删除。企业可以通过该模块了解客户的基本信息、购买记录、售后服务等,从而更好地维护客户关系。
2. 产品管理模块
产品管理模块负责对产品信息进行录入、查询、修改和删除。企业可以通过该模块管理产品的价格、库存、销售情况等,确保产品信息的准确性。
3. 销售管理模块
销售管理模块负责对销售订单、销售退货、销售统计等进行管理。企业可以通过该模块实时了解销售情况,为销售决策提供数据支持。
4. 采购管理模块
采购管理模块负责对采购订单、采购退货、采购统计等进行管理。企业可以通过该模块优化采购流程,降低采购成本。
5. 售后服务模块
售后服务模块负责对客户投诉、维修记录、售后服务评价等进行管理。企业可以通过该模块提高客户满意度,提升品牌形象。
6. 报表统计模块
报表统计模块负责对销售数据、采购数据、库存数据等进行统计分析,为企业决策提供数据支持。

1. 技术选型
ASP.NET销售管理系统采用.NET Framework作为开发平台,使用C作为编程语言,数据库采用SQL Server。这种技术组合具有以下优势:
(1)跨平台性
ASP.NET支持多种操作系统,如Windows、Linux等,便于企业部署和运维。
(2)安全性
ASP.NET提供了丰富的安全机制,如身份验证、授权等,确保系统数据的安全。
(3)易用性
ASP.NET提供了丰富的控件和组件,便于开发人员快速构建功能强大的系统。
2. 系统架构
ASP.NET销售管理系统采用B/S架构,分为客户端和服务器端。客户端负责展示用户界面,服务器端负责处理业务逻辑和数据存储。
3. 系统实现
系统实现过程中,主要采用以下技术:
(1)ASP.NET MVC框架
ASP.NET MVC框架用于构建Web应用程序,实现前后端分离,提高开发效率。
(2)Entity Framework
Entity Framework用于实现数据访问层,简化数据库操作。
(3)AJAX技术
AJAX技术用于实现异步数据交互,提高用户体验。
ASP.NET销售管理系统通过实现销售过程的自动化、智能化,帮助企业提高销售效率,降低运营成本。本文对ASP.NET销售管理系统的设计与实现进行了探讨,为企业提供了有益的参考。